I removed three rollers this evening, and then I put them right back in. The bike might launch just slightly better with them removed but it hit the rev limit at a very slow speed. I lost all the top end. Now I understand why everyone upgrades the ignition when they pull three rollers. Ours still has a very acceptable top speed with the 48 tooth sprocket and all six rollers. I'm keeping the clutch stock, and I'll mill the head when I get around to it. I'm just about satisfied with it.
Mods so far:
CT Racing Pipe
K&N filter with outer wear
75 main jet, 22.5 pilot
48 tooth sprocket - best money spent yet!
